The Razr name is synonymous with flip phones, and its latest addition has only continued its streak of quality. In their review, our friends over at Tom's Guide applauded the Razr 50's large cover display, long-lasting battery life and bright main screen that comes at a much more affordable price than its competitors. At its AU$1,1199 RRP, it offers a premium experience at a mid-range price and, at 30% off, there is no foldable phone with its price-to-performance ratio.

Buying through Optus means you get more benefits than just a cheaper outright purchase, as you'll also get this discounted price when buying the Razr 50 on a 12, 24 or 36-month plan. However, while your device costs will set you back just AU$33.27 per month on a 24-month plan, pairing it with Optus' most affordable phone plan will jack that up to AU$85.27. So, if you're looking for affordability, the best option is to snag this flip phone outright, and pair it with one of our best sim-only plans.

In our Motorola Edge 50 Pro review, we called it a mid-range marvel – excelling as a camera phone with an excellent display, premium build and exceptional charge speed. And, while we couldn't call it ‘cheap’ at full price, it was perfect for those looking for quality without spending flagship money. At AU$699 though, it's the #1 choice for anyone looking for a budget-friendly handset – bringing it to just AU$100 more than the Motorola Edge 50 Fusion, Motorola's impressive budget offering.
